Are air fryers good for gluten-free?
Yes! An air fryer can cook such a variety of food, it makes for an amazing appliance for gluten-free eating. And yes, you can use the air fryer without flour. You can skip the breading all together or switch it up and use almond flour or pork rinds to make delicious breaded meals too.
Are air fryers good for celiacs?
Air fryers work by circulating hot air around the food being “fried.” The fan motion that circulates air could blow particles of previously cooked, gluten-containing food onto gluten-free food being cooked. Don’t use the same air fryer for gluten-free and gluten-containing cooking.

Can I make bacon in an air fryer?
Bacon is safe to cook in the air fryer, but you need to make sure that you use the proper temperature and that your air fryer is clean before you begin. The best bacon air fryer temperature is 350 degrees F. This will crisp the bacon without causing it to smoke or burn.

Can gluten in the air harm you?
If there is a risk of any flour or particles of gluten in the air, it is safest to avoid those areas for the next 24 hours. While simply touching gluten will not harm an individual with celiac disease, there can be a risk of ingesting airborne gluten, which is usually caused by flour.
Can celiacs use the same dishwasher?
Have you ever wondered if it is safe to wash plates that have had both gluten-free (GF) and gluten-containing on them, in the same load? As long as you are using a functional dishwasher that effectively removes food particles and cleans thoroughly, this is fine.
Can you put aluminum foil in the air fryer?
Aluminum foil can be used in an air fryer, but it should only go in the basket. Acidic foods react with aluminum, so avoid using foil when air frying tomatoes, peppers, or citrus. Using parchment paper or a bare basket is better than foil because it won’t interfere with cooking.
Can u air fry an egg?
Place cold eggs into the air fryer basket. Air fry the fresh eggs at 270 degrees Fahrenheit for 17 minutes of cook time. Carefully remove the cooked eggs from the basket of the air fryer and place them into a bowl of ice water. Remove the eggs from the ice water bath after 10 minutes.
Can I put paper towel in air fryer?
Paper towels can disrupt the airflow which could cause fire or damage to your unit. In addition to unevenly cooked food, paper towels are flameable and should never be used ever in an air fryer during cooking.
